PCTFE, or polychlorotrifluoroethylene, is a high-performance polymer that is widely used in various industries for its excellent mechanical and chemical properties PCTFE rods are one of the products made from this material, known for their exceptional strength, durability, and resistance to chemicals In this article, we will explore the characteristics of PCTFE rods, their uses, and the benefits they offer.
PCTFE rods are made from a rigid and translucent material that is known for its outstanding mechanical strength These rods are lightweight, making them easy to handle and transport They have excellent resistance to corrosion, making them ideal for use in harsh chemical environments PCTFE rods also have a low coefficient of friction, which makes them suitable for applications where smooth motion is critical.
One of the most notable features of PCTFE rods is their exceptional chemical resistance They can withstand exposure to a wide range of chemicals, including acids, bases, solvents, and fuels This makes them ideal for use in chemical processing plants, laboratories, and other industrial settings where exposure to harsh chemicals is common PCTFE rods are also resistant to moisture, making them suitable for outdoor applications where they may be exposed to rain or humidity.
In addition to their chemical resistance, PCTFE rods also offer excellent electrical insulation properties They have a high dielectric strength, meaning they can withstand high voltages without conducting electricity This makes them suitable for use in electrical and electronic applications where insulation is critical PCTFE rods are also stable at high temperatures, making them suitable for use in applications where heat resistance is required.
PCTFE rods have a smooth surface finish, which reduces friction and wear when they are in motion This makes them ideal for use in applications such as bearings, bushings, and seals where smooth operation is essential pctfe rod. PCTFE rods are also easy to machine and fabricate, allowing them to be customized to fit specific applications They can be easily cut, drilled, and shaped to create the desired size and shape.
One of the key advantages of using PCTFE rods is their long service life They are highly durable and can withstand heavy loads and repeated use without degrading This makes them a cost-effective option for many applications, as they do not need frequent replacement or maintenance PCTFE rods also have excellent dimensional stability, meaning they will not warp or deform over time, ensuring consistent performance over the long term.
PCTFE rods are used in a wide range of industries and applications due to their superior properties They are commonly used in the aerospace industry for components such as seals, bearings, and bushings PCTFE rods are also used in the chemical processing industry for valves, fittings, and pump components In the medical industry, PCTFE rods are used for surgical instruments, implants, and laboratory equipment Other applications include food processing, automotive, and electronics.
